Q: Is 110,016,636 a Prime Number?
A: No, 110,016,636 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 110016636 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 23 46 69 92 138 276 398,611 797,222 1,195,833 1,594,444 2,391,666 4,783,332 9,168,053 18,336,106 27,504,159 36,672,212 55,008,318 and 110,016,636, with no remainder.
Since 110,016,636 cannot be divided by just 1 and 110,016,636, it is not a prime number.
